Hi folks,
I was wondering, is a heavy clutch pedal a sign of impending failure ? It's not quite at the stage where it needs an anvil dropped on it, but it's very stiff compared to my Mondeo, and I imagine it would become very tiresome on a long journey. It's been on my long list of faults to investigate since I got the car, I guess now it's time to start looking at the possibilities.... Any thoughts appreciated... All 2.1 tds have a heavy clutch, it just seems to be a charactertistic. Having said that, my last one was quite light but was also worn out, slipped if you pushed it hard!
The one I have now was exeptionally heavy when I bought it and would not engage smoothly, I found the problem to be due to the operating shaft in the bell housing trying to seize up. I ran some oil down the shaft from under the operating lever and the difference was amazing, might be worth a try. Peter.N. -------------------- Used to have:

I have found that lubricating the cable with molyslip can give considerable improvement. It is best to drip it down the inner cable at the pedal end. Its not easy to get at

Hi Ciaran, Your heavy clutch as Peter said may be due to the shaft that transfers movment from the lever on top of the bell housing(just under the battery )run some oil down around it where it goes into the bell housing.
Also the cable can be lubricated near the same position ,i have used aerosol silicone oil in the past you must care fully slip a small screwdriver up inbetween the inner and outer cable and spray oil into the cable using the thin tube as on wd40 cans . Also if you look behind the cylinder head at the left side facing the wind screen you can see where the clutch cable linkage arm is ,this transfers the pedal cable onto the clutch cable where it runs along the engine bulkhead .There is a plastic right angle pivot just there which may also need some lubrication,it joins the cable from the pedal to the cable which goes onto the clutch arm on the bell housing. I had a very noisy graunchy feeling clutch operation when i first got my xm but spraying around all the moving parts cured it completely .
